Hi, I am ±·¾±Ã±²¹, 23 y/o from the Philippines. My Dutch boyfriend and I are planning to live together in the Netherlands without marriage and registered partnership. He could be a good sponsor for me but in what way? What could be some possible ways to realize it? Having a work would not be a good option for me as I am not a highly skilled worker. Hi ±·¾±Ã±²¹ and welcome to the Forum.

You will probably have to go the MVV route; MVV is a joint residence and work permit.  One important requirement for you to realise is that it includes a Dutch language examination as part of the process. 

If you're not sure, I suggest you get your boyfriend to contact the IND and find out what options there are available to you; this will take you straight to the their website.

Once you know what avenue to take, he can begin the process and you can come back to us if you have any specific questions.
